Full job description

  • Location: Smithers, BC
  • Job Status: Full Time Seasonal
  • Compensation: $42-$45/hr (trip rated)
  • Live out Allowance: $50/night for non-local drivers
  • Travel: Flat Rate Travel Paid for non-local drivers
  • Benefits: Full Benefits include dental, life insurance, pharmaceutical, vision care, chiropractor, massage, EAP, and more. 100% paid by Stromsten
  • Schedule:
  • Monday to Saturday
  • 10 hour cycle times | 6 loads per week
  • Job Description
  • Tandem Tractor with Super B Dump trailers
  • Route A: Smithers to Stewart Area, back to Smithers
  • Route B: Smithers to Vanderhoof Area, back to Smithers

Responsibilities

  • Supervise and manage cargo handling activities, ensuring loads are properly secured, equipment is prepared, safe work practices are followed, and all applicable Acts and Regulations are met.
  • Complete pre-trip, en route, and post-trip inspections on assigned equipment to confirm safe operation, roadworthiness, and regulatory compliance.
  • Follow all applicable laws and requirements related to safe vehicle operation, load securement, hours of service, occupational health and safety, transportation of dangerous goods, and weight and dimension limits.
  • Adhere to company policies, site protocols, operating procedures, performance standards, and regulatory requirements.
  • Safely and efficiently position trucks and trailers for loading and unloading, following direction from loading personnel when required, and confirming that the vehicle and any specialized loading equipment are properly aligned.
  • Operate loading equipment when required by the position.
  • Inspect mobile equipment, including front-end loaders, to confirm mechanical and safety systems are operating properly.
  • Immediately report vehicle defects, accidents, traffic violations, or equipment damage to the appropriate supervisor.
  • Identify and report unsafe conditions or hazards at loading sites, unloading areas, yards, shops, and other work locations.
  • Prepare, review, maintain, and verify all required paperwork and documentation, including bills of lading, to ensure accuracy and completeness.
  • Use truck-mounted computers, CB radios, telephones, and other communication tools to exchange required information with dispatch, supervisors, terminals, and other drivers.
  • Complete electronic and/or paper logs for hours of service, vehicle service, repair status, and other required records in accordance with provincial and federal regulations.
  • Communicate professionally, clearly, and respectfully with customers, co-workers, supervisors, site personnel, and the public.
  • Assist with loading and unloading trucks as required.
  • Conduct inspections before, during, and after transport to ensure the load remains properly secured and safe for travel.
  • Ensure materials are protected from weather and environmental exposure, including tarping loads when required.
  • Clean up any debris or material resulting from loading or unloading activities.
  • Provide timely feedback to dispatch or supervisors regarding customer concerns, mechanical issues, delivery challenges, or other operational matters.
  • Treat customers, co-workers, contractors, and members of the public with professionalism and respect at all times.
  • Train and support other employees when required.

You Possess

  • Demonstrated experience driving in snow and installing tire chains when conditions require.
  • Ability to safely operate in adverse weather and challenging road conditions.
  • Super B and mountain driving experience considered an asset.
  • High School Diploma, GED, or equivalent education.
  • Valid Class 1 driver’s licence and completion of MELT requirements.
  • Clean driver’s abstract or acceptable driving record.
  • Valid air brake endorsement.
  • Ability to communicate effectively in English, both verbally and in writing, including reading safety documents, completing reports, and communicating with dispatch and site personnel.
  • Physical ability to move up to 100 lbs, lift 50 lbs overhead, and lift up to 75 lbs to shoulder height.
  • Ability to sit for extended periods.
  • Ability to successfully complete a pre-employment drug test.
  • Willingness and ability to receive, understand, and follow direction.
  • Ability to participate in cross-training and learn all required facility functions.
  • Strong commitment to safety and quality.
  • Responsible, accountable, dependable, and reliable.
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ills.
  • Positive attitude, strong work ethic, and ability to contribute to a team environment.
  • Flexible and adaptable, with strong interpersonal skills and the ability to work effectively with diverse teams and individuals.
  • Computer literacy.
  • Basic knowledge of truck and trailer maintenance requirements.
  • Strong organizational skills, including the ability to prioritize tasks and meet deadlines.
  • Professional and mature conduct, including during stressful or high-pressure situations.
  • Ability to work independently with minimal supervision and remain self-directed.
